希赛考试网
首页 > 软考 > 软件设计师

c语言规范书写格式示例

希赛网 2023-12-25 15:20:31

C语言是一种功能强大的编程语言,因其强大的控制能力和高效的执行效率而深受程序员的喜爱。但是,C语言的规范书写格式对程序的可读性和可维护性具有重要的影响。本文将从语法规范、代码布局、变量命名等多个角度,介绍C语言规范书写格式的具体要求和示例。

语法规范

1. 大括号的使用

C语言中的大括号是编写代码时非常重要的元素,正确使用可以增加可读性和可维护性。通常情况下,左大括号应该和if、for、while等语句写在同一行,而不是新起一行。例如:

if (condition) {

// do something

}

2. 换行和空格的使用

在C语言中,换行和空格的使用有助于增强程序的可读性和整齐性。正确使用换行和空格可以使代码看起来更加舒适、整洁。例如:

int main() {

int a = 1;

int b = 2;

if (a > b) {

printf("a is greater than b\n");

} else {

printf("b is greater than a\n");

}

return 0;

}

代码布局

1. 使用缩进控制代码结构

正确的代码缩进可以使代码看起来更直观、清晰。可以使用4个空格或1个制表符来缩进代码。例如:

int main() {

int a = 1;

for (int i = 0; i < 10; i++) {

if (i % 2 == 0) {

printf("%d is even\n", i);

} else {

printf("%d is odd\n", i);

}

}

return 0;

}

2. 限制每行的字符数

合理限制每行的字符数可以使代码的可读性和可维护性更强。C语言规范建议每行不超过80个字符。例如:

printf("This is a very long string, "

"it should be broken into multiple lines.");

变量命名

1. 变量名应该具有描述性

变量名应该描述变量所保存的数据,具有描述性的变量名可以使代码更可读、更易于维护。例如:

int age = 20;

char *name = "John Smith";

2. 遵循命名规范

C语言规范建议使用小写字母命名变量,单词之间使用下划线连接。例如:

int user_id = 123;

float account_balance = 1000.0;

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件